Embodiment 1

[0013] A gear cleaning method is characterized in that it includes the following steps: a. Before cleaning, check whether there are burrs, scale, welding slag, iron beans, etc. on the parts, and if there are any, they should be removed;

[0014] b. Put the parts into a container containing diesel, kerosene or alcohol cleaning solution, heat it to 85°C with a stove under the pool, boil and wash for 4 minutes, and stir the cleaning solution while boiling.

[0015] c. Use ultrasonic equipment for ultrasonic cleaning; take it out and put it into the pool, and use a high-pressure water spray gun for high-pressure cleaning of 2.0 MPa;

[0016] d. After rinsing, perform annealing treatment at a temperature of 330 degrees Celsius;

[0017] e. Use a low-frequency AC demagnetizer to demagnetize the gears;

[0018] f. Rinse the gears with clean water and dry them with a dryer at a temperature of 90°C for 1.5 hours.

Abstract

The invention discloses a wheel gear cleaning method. The wheel gear cleaning method comprises the following steps: putting parts in a container filled with diesel oil, kerosene or an alcohol rinse-solution, using a cooking stove for heating the parts to the temperature of 80-90 DEG C, boiling the parts for 3-5 min, stirring the rinse-solution while boiling; employing ultrasonic equipment for ultrasonic cleaning; taking the parts out and putting the parts into a water pool, using a high-pressure water gun for high-pressure flushing; annealing the parts after flushing at the temperature of 300-350 DEG C; using a low-frequency AC demagnetization machine for performing demagnetization on the wheel gear; rinsing the wheel gear by clear water, and drying the wheel gear by a dryer. According to the invention, a traditional cleaning mode combines with a modern advanced cleaning mode, so that the cleaning is thoroughly, and the usage life of the wheel gear is prolonged.

Description

technical field [0001] The invention belongs to the field of machinery, and in particular relates to a gear cleaning method. Background technique [0002] At present, the commonly used method of cleaning gears in the market is ultrasonic cleaning, and chemical cleaning for oil stains. However, the combination of the two is required, the cost of the equipment is high, and the cleaning effect cannot be guaranteed, and if some other cleaning methods need to be added, it may be more troublesome and increase the cost. Therefore, the present invention provides a gear cleaning method. Contents of the invention [0003] The purpose of the present invention is to provide a gear cleaning method, which uses traditional cleaning methods combined with modern advanced cleaning methods to clean more thoroughly.
